90210 is an American teen drama television series developed by Rob Thomas, Jeff Judah and Gabe Sachs. It is the fourth series in the Beverly Hills, 90210 franchise created by Darren Star.

This reinvented series looks at life through the eyes of Annie Wilson and her brother Dixon, whose first day at West Beverly Hills High School leaves no doubt that they're not in their hometown of Kansas anymore.

The series aired in the USA on The CW from 2 September, 2008 to 13 May, 2013. There are 114 hour-long episodes in five seasons.

90210 premiered in South Africa on M-Net on Thursday 8 January 2009, at 19h30. It was moved to DStv's Vuzu channel for Season 3, to M-Net Series for Season 4 and to M-Net Series Showcase (simulcast in HD) for Season 5. See "Seasons" below for seasonal broadcast dates and times.

Season 5 premiered on M-Net Series Showcase on Saturday 13 July 2013, at 17h30. New episodes broadcast in a quadruple bill, weekly. There are 22 episodes in the fifth and final season.

Season 5

The fifth and final season of 90210 finds the gang struggling with the biggest issues of their lives.

Having put their relatively carefree days at West Beverly behind them and launched themselves into adulthood, they will search for answers to their trials and tribulations with only their friendships to lean on.

They will experience new love and old flames, loyalties being challenged and shocking betrayals. Some friendships will be tested, others will be renewed and new people who will try to infiltrate the close circle of friends.

There are some things money can't buy, even in 90210.

The series stars Shenae Grimes as Annie Wilson, Tristan Wilds as Dixon Wilson, AnnaLynne McCord as Naomi Clark, Jessica Stroup as Silver, Michael Steger as Navid Shirazi, Jessica Lowndes as Adrianna Tate-Duncan and Matt Lanter as Liam Court.

90210 is produced by CBS Television Studios with executive producers Patti Carr (Life Unexpected, Private Practice) and Lara Olsen (Life Unexpected, Private Practice).

Seasons

Note: the first two seasons aired on M-Net, after which the show was moved to Vuzu. After one season on Vuzu the show was moved to M-Net Series and for the final season it was moved to M-Net Series Showcase (the first season to be simulcast in HD).

Season 1 (24 episodes)

Channel: M-Net | Premiere: 8 Jan 2009 | Finale: 18 Jun 2009 | Thu, 19h30

Season 2 (22 episodes)

Channel: M-Net | Premiere: 1 Apr 2010 | Finale: 26 Aug 2010 | Thu, 19h30

Season 3 (22 episodes)

Channel: Vuzu | Premiere: 21 Sep 2011 | Finale: 15 Feb 2012 | Wed, 20h30

Season 4 (24 episodes)

Channel: M-Net Series | Premiere: 5 Jan 2013 | Finale: 23 Mar 2013 | Sat, 20h30

Season 5 (22 episodes)

Channel: M-Net Series Showcase | Premiere: 13 Jul 2013 | Finale: 17 Aug 2013 | Sat, 17h30
